Introduction
A logo is a component of a brand, representing your company's identity and products. According to your needs, you can use a different logo in each brand that you create.
While a brand is applied to an entire video, in an individual scene, the logo can be changed, hidden, or removed completely.
Where is the Logo Displayed?
The logo is displayed in a logo placeholder, according to the scene layout that you selected. By default, the logo is displayed automatically as part of the brand.

Media Specifications and Recommendations
The logo you upload can be an image or video footage.
● Supported image formats: PNG (recommended because of transparent background), JPG, and GIF
● Maximum file size: 10 MB
● Aspect ratio should be rectangular, 3:1
● Recommended dimensions are 300 (width) x 100 (height) pixels
● White/clear space around the image should be cropped, leaving a minimum margin of 5 pixels (see example below):

Uploading a Logo to a New Brand
1. |
In the Studio, click Brand in the sidebar. |
2. | Locate the new brand that you are creating. |
3. | On the brand thumbnail, click the three-dot menu and then select Edit. |
4. | Upload the logo using either of the following options: |
Upload the file by clicking browse or by dragging the file into the area bordered by the dotted lines. Click Choose From Media Library to upload a media asset from the Getty media libraries.
|
|
5. |
(Optional) If you need to crop the media asset, see Cropping a Logo. |
6. |
Click Save. |
|
|
The logo is added to the brand thumbnail. |

Replacing a Logo in a Brand
1. |
In the Studio, click Brand in the sidebar. |
2. |
Locate the brand whose logo you want to replace. |
3. |
On the brand thumbnail, click the three-dot menu and then select Edit. |
4. | On the logo thumbnail, click the three-dot menu and then select Replace. |
5. | Replace the logo using either of the following options: |
Upload the file by clicking browse or by dragging the file into the area bordered by the dotted lines. Click Choose From Media Library to upload a media asset from the Getty media libraries.
|
|
The logo is replaced. |
|
6. | (Optional) If you need to crop the media asset, see Cropping a Logo. |
7. | Click Save. |
The logo will now be updated in all the videos using this brand. |

Removing a Logo
If you remove the logo from a brand, the logo will no longer be displayed in videos connected to that brand.
Note:
If you would like to remove the logo from an individual scene in a specific video, see Changing the Default Logo in a Scene.
1. |
Access the brand whose logo you want to remove. |
Show me how
|
|
2. |
On the logo thumbnail, click the three-dot menu and then select Remove. |
3. | Click Save. |
The logo is removed from the brand. |
